Molecular imprinted polymer (MIP) against cephalexin was synthesized by co-polymerization of func tional monomer, cross-linker, radical initiator, along with target molecule (cephalexin) in a porogenic
material. Binding of cephalexin towards prepared MIP was studied in different solvents (water, methanol,
1 M NaCl, acetone and acetonitrile) and best binding was observed in methanol. Partition coefficient and
selectivity of prepared imprint and non-imprint was also studied. Cross reactivity in terms of binding effi ciency was also assessed with other antibiotics. Chromatographic study of MIP was carried out by pack ing prepared imprint into glass column. MIP was used as matrix in solid phase extraction (SPE) for
recovery of cephalexin from spiked milk samples for further estimation by high performance liquid chro matography. No interference was observed from milk components after elution of cephalexin from MIP,
indicating selectivity and affinity of MIP. On the other hand, interference was observed in eluate obtained
from C18 SPE column.
